Event 5: Capitol Building Visit

During our visit to the capitol building we handed out legislation in regards to creating a standardized mental health education curriculum in high schools all across PA. We were able to hand out and lobby for our legislation to 65+ PA Representatives, 5 Senators, the Lieutenant Governor's staff, and the Governor's staff. We were also fortunate enough to have a meeting with Representative Parker and Representative Smith to discuss the importance of mental health education within the Commonwealth along with the feasibility of our bill.

Event 9: Penn Medicine & Young Chances Foundation:

The Huddle: Men's Mental Health Conversation

Thank you to Penn Medicine & the Young Chances Foundation for inviting us to the "The Huddle." At the event we were able inform 500+ people about mental health, along with advocating for the importance of men's mental health. Additionally, we enjoyed listening to the 5 five panelists and their mental health journey: Julius Erving (76ers Legend), Brian Westbrook (Former Eagles Running Back), Rodney Babb (Penn Medicine Trauma Recovery Specialist), and Tyrique Glasgow (Founder of YCF), Ishan Hines (Founder of My Brother Keeper's Care).
